DAX函数在PowerBI中的数据预测与趋势分析
发布时间: 2024-02-23 16:04:45 阅读量: 50 订阅数: 49
powerbi DAX函数
# 1. 介绍
## 1.1 什么是DAX函数?
DAX(Data Analysis Expressions)函数是一种用于分析和计算数据的函数语言,最初是为Microsoft Power Pivot和Power BI设计的。它类似于Excel中的函数,但更强大和灵活,能够处理更复杂的数据分析和计算需求。
## 1.2 PowerBI中的数据预测与趋势分析的重要性
在PowerBI中进行数据预测与趋势分析可以帮助用户更好地理解数据背后的规律和趋势,为业务决策提供支持。通过对历史数据的分析和预测,可以发现潜在的商机和风险,指导未来的业务发展方向。
## 1.3 本文的结构和内容概要
本文将首先介绍DAX函数的基础知识,包括概述、应用场景、基本语法和常用函数;接着简要介绍数据预测与趋势分析的概念及其重要性;然后重点探讨如何利用DAX函数在PowerBI中进行数据预测和趋势分析,包括简单数据预测、趋势分析以及预测模型构建与评估;最后通过实例分析展示不同场景下的数据预测与趋势分析方法。文章结尾对本文内容进行总结,并展望未来DAX函数在数据预测与趋势分析中的发展趋势。
# 2. DAX函数基础
在PowerBI中,DAX(Data Analysis Expressions)函数是一种强大的函数语言,用于对数据模型中的数据进行计算、过滤和分析。通过使用DAX函数,用户可以根据需要创建复杂的计算字段,以支持数据分析和可视化需求。
### DAX函数概述
DAX函数可以分为以下几类:
- 数学和三角函数:如SUM、AVERAGE、SIN等
- 文本函数:如CONCATENATE、LEFT、RIGHT等
- 逻辑函数:如IF、AND、OR等
- 时间智能函数:如DATEADD、DATESBETWEEN、TOTALYTD等
### DAX函数在PowerBI中的应用场景
DAX函数在PowerBI中具有广泛的应用场景,常用于:
- 创建计算字段:通过DAX函数可以对现有字段进行计算,生成新的计算字段,以满足特定的分析需求。
- 进行数据过滤:可以利用DAX函数对数据模型进行过滤,筛选出需要的数据子集,以便进一步分析。
- 实现数据聚合:通过DAX函数可以进行数据聚合操作,如对销售额进行累积求和、计算同比增长率等。
### DAX函数的基本语法和常用函数
DAX函数的基本语法包括函数名称和参数列表,如:
```
SUMX(table, expression)
```
其中,SUMX为函数名称,table表示要计算的表,expression表示要进行计算的表达式。
常用的DAX函数包括:
- SUM:对指定列或表达式进行求和计算
- AVERAGE:计算指定列或表达式的平均值
- CALCULATE:在更改当前过滤上下文的情况下重新计算表达式的值
- MAX:返回指定列或表达式的最大值
在接下来的章节中,我们将通过具体案例演示如何使用DAX函数进行数据预测和趋势分析。
# 3. 数据预测与趋势分析简介
在数据分析的领域中,数据预测和趋势分析是非常重要的内容。通过对历史数据的分析和建模,我们可以预测未来的趋势和走势,从而帮助企业做出更明智的决策。在PowerBI这样的商业智能工具中,数据预测和趋势分析更是被广泛应用。下面我们来了解一下数据预测与趋势分析的基本概念和方法。
#### 3.1 什么是数据预测和趋势分析?
数据预测是指通过对已有数据进行建模和分析,利用数学和统计方法来预测未来的数值走势或事件发生的概率。趋势分析则是指通过对数据的变化趋势进行观察和分析,找出其中的规律和特征。两者结合可以帮助我们更准确地了解数据的发展方向和潜在规律。
#### 3.2 为什么在PowerBI中进行数据预测和趋势分析?
PowerBI作为一款强大的商业智能工具,提供了丰富的数据处理和可视化功能,能够有效地帮助用户进行数据预测和趋势分析。通过PowerBI中的各种工具和函数,用户可以方便地对数据进行建模和分析,实现数据预测和趋势分析,为企业决策提供科学依据。
#### 3.3 数据预测与趋势分析的主要方法和技术
数
0
0